Nissan Magnite expands globally with first shipment to LHD markets

The new Nissan Magnite, a B-SUV launched by Nissan Motor India in October 2024, is now expanding its presence in global Left-Hand Drive (LHD) markets, an official news release stated.

In late January 2025, Nissan Motor India marked a significant milestone by flagging off its first shipment of nearly 2,900 LHD units of the Magnite from the Kamarajar Port (KPL) in Chennai, India.

This shipment is headed to select markets in the LATAM region, reinforcing Nissan’s ‘One Car One World’ strategy and emphasizing India’s role as a key hub for global exports.

By February 2025, Nissan will export over 7,100 units of the New Magnite as part of the second wave, targeting markets in the Middle East, North Africa, and the Asia Pacific region. By the end of February, the company will have exported over 10,000 units of the LHD version of the New Magnite.

The New Magnite has been designed to cater to customers worldwide, boasting a range of features that make it an appealing choice.

With a bold front grille, sleek LED headlights, and a dynamic stance, the Magnite makes a strong visual statement on the road.

It comes equipped with an 8-inch touchscreen infotainment system that supports Apple CarPlay and Android Auto for seamless connectivity. Other convenient features include a remote engine start, air ionizer, and a cooled glovebox.

A comprehensive suite of safety features includes six airbags, Anti-lock Braking System (ABS), Electronic Brakeforce Distribution (EBD), Vehicle Dynamic Control (VDC), and a rearview camera for added peace of mind.

Powered by an advanced turbocharged 1.0-litre engine, the Magnite is available with both manual and Continuously Variable Transmission (CVT) options.

Manufactured at Nissan’s Alliance JV plant in Chennai, the LHD variant of the New Magnite signifies India’s pivotal role as a manufacturing and export hub for Nissan. The New Magnite will soon be available in over 65 global markets, including most LHD markets.

With the growing popularity of the ‘Made in India’ New Nissan Magnite, the company is showcasing its technological expertise and manufacturing strength on the global stage.

Following the launch of the New Magnite, Nissan Motor India also began exporting the Right-Hand Drive (RHD) version of the SUV to South Africa, marking a successful debut in the African market. Within a month of its global launch in India, over 2,700 units of the RHD Magnite were shipped from Chennai to South Africa, further solidifying the SUV’s global appeal.

Since its debut in December 2020, the New Nissan Magnite has made a strong impact both in India and abroad, surpassing 170,000 cumulative sales. The updated version of the Magnite features a tougher, bolder design that enhances its road presence, with more premium exterior and interior details.
